Three months after their public fallout, Musk and Trump appeared together for the first time at the Charlie Kirk memorial event.

According to media reports, at the memorial service held on Sunday for Kirk, who was shot and killed, Musk and Trump were spotted sitting side by side and chatting happily. This scene occurred just before U.S. Secretary of Defense Pete Hegseth was about to take the stage. Television footage captured Musk approaching Trump and sitting down in the empty seat next to him, after which the two shook hands and engaged in enthusiastic conversation.

The relationship between the two had reached a freezing point in June of this year.

At that time, Musk "in a fit of anger" resigned from government-related positions and launched sharp criticisms of Trump on social media platforms. Musk hinted in a series of posts that Trump's involvement in the Epstein scandal might be deeper than the public knows. He wrote, "It's time to drop the real bombshell."

In response to Musk's public challenge, Trump did not back down and retaliated. He also threatened on social media that he might use national power to "crush" Musk's business interests. Trump wrote at the time, "I have always been surprised that Biden hasn't done this!"

This public dispute led many to believe that the political alliance between the two had completely broken down. However, at Sunday's Kirk memorial event, the two reconciled.

Afterward, Musk posted a photo with Trump on social media, captioned only "For Charlie," suggesting that this thawing was in memory of their mutual friend Kirk.

Kirk had previously expressed belief that Musk and the president would eventually reconcile. "I know both of them very well," Kirk said during a summer interview with Megyn Kelly. "I think they will reconcile at some point," he added, "I think they will be stronger together."
